How to distinguish skill-based games from chance-based games in a casino

When venturing into a casino, understanding the difference between skill-based games and chance-based games is essential for players aiming to optimize their experience. Skill-based games require players to apply strategy, knowledge, and decision-making to influence the outcome, whereas chance-based games rely primarily on luck without much room for player intervention. Recognizing these distinctions helps gamblers approach games with realistic expectations and a clearer understanding of their potential to succeed.

Generally, skill-based games like poker or blackjack involve significant player input, where learning strategies and reading opponents can improve odds over time. In contrast, chance-based games such as slot machines or roulette depend largely on random number generators or fixed probabilities, making outcomes unpredictable and unaffected by player skill. Casinos often offer both types to cater to diverse player preferences, but the key difference lies in how much control the player has over the game’s result.
